2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t

2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t

ID:58866972

大小:1.49 MB

页数:45页

时间:2020-09-30

2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t_第1页
2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t_第2页
2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t_第3页
2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t_第4页
2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t_第5页
资源描述:

《2015高考数学(人教A版 理)配套课件:9-1 算法与程序框图.ppt》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、第九章 算法、统计、统计案例[最新考纲展示]1.了解算法的含义,了解算法的思想.2.理解算法框图的三种基本结构:顺序结构、条件结构、循环结构.3.了解几种基本算法语句——输入语句、输出语句、赋值语句、条件语句、循环语句的含义.第一节 算法与程序框图算法的定义算法是指按照解决某一类问题的和的步骤.一定规则明确有限程序框图1.程序框图又称,是一种用、及来表示算法的图形.2.程序框图通常由和组成.3.基本的程序框有、、、.流程图程序框流程线文字说明程序框流程线终端框(起止框)输入、输出框处理框(执行框)判断框三种基本逻辑结构基本

2、算法语句1.输入、输出、赋值语句的格式与功能2.条件语句的格式及框图(1)IF—THEN格式(2)IF—THEN—ELSE格式3.循环语句的格式及框图(1)UNTIL语句(2)WHILE语句____________________[通关方略]____________________解决程序框图问题时应注意(1)不要混淆处理框和输入框.(2)注意区分条件结构和循环结构.(3)注意区分当型循环和直到型循环.(4)循环结构中要正确控制循环次数.(5)要注意各个框的顺序.答案:C答案:D答案:C4.当a=1,b=3时,执行完下面一

3、段过程后x的值是________.解析:∵a33,循环结束,故输出的S的值是63.答案:63算法的基本结构【例1】(2013年高考江西卷)阅读如下程序框图,如果输出i=4,那么空白的判断框中应填入的条件是()A.S<8B.S<9C.S<10D.S<11[解析

4、]由框图及输出i=4可知循环应为:i=2,S=5;i=3,S=8;i=4,S=9,输出i=4,所以应填入的条件是S<9,故选B.[答案]B反思总结1.解决程序框图问题要注意几个常用变量(1)计数变量:用来记录某个事件发生的次数,如i=i+1;(2)累加变量:用来计算数据之和,如S=S+i;(3)累乘变量:用来计算数据之积,如p=p×i.2.处理循环结构的框图问题,关键是理解并认清终止循环结构的条件及循环次数.变式训练1.若如下框图所给的程序运行结果为S=20,那么判断框中应填入的关于k的条件是()A.k=9?B.k≤8?C

5、.k<8?D.k>8?解析:据程序框图可得当k=9时,S=11;k=8时,S=11+9=20.∴应填入“k>8?”答案:D程序框图的应用【例2】(2014年广州模拟)阅读如图所示的程序框图,则输出的S=________.[解析]由框图知,程序执行的功能为:S=(3×1-1)+(3×2-1)+(3×3-1)+(3×4-1)+(3×5-1)=3×(1+2+3+4+5)-5=40.[答案]40答案:3775反思总结1.识别、运行程序框图和完善程序框图的思路(1)要明确程序框图的顺序结构、条件分支结构和循环结构.(2)要识别、运行

6、程序框图,理解框图所解决的实际问题.(3)按照题目的要求完成解答并验证.2.解决程序框图问题时的注意点(1)不要混淆处理框和输入框.(2)注意区分条件分支结构和循环结构.(3)注意区分当型循环和直到型循环.(4)循环结构中要正确控制循环次数.(5)要注意各个框的顺序.基本算法语句【例3】(2013年高考陕西卷)根据下列算法语句,当输入x为60时,输出y的值为()A.25B.30C.31D.61[答案]C反思总结1.输入语句、输出语句和赋值语句基本对应于算法的顺序结构.2.在循环语句中也可以嵌套条件语句,甚至是循环语句,此时

7、需要注意嵌套格式,这些语句需要保证算法的完整性,否则就会造成程序无法执行.变式训练2.下面程序运行的结果为()A.4B.5C.6D.7解析:第一次执行后,S=100-10=90,n=10-1=9;第二次执行后,S=90-9=81,n=9-1=8;第三次执行后,S=81-8=73,n=8-1=7;第四次执行后,S=73-7=66,n=7-1=6.此时S=66≤70,结束循环,输出n=6.答案:C——算法的交汇性问题算法是新课标高考的一大热点,其中算法的交汇性问题已成为高考的一大亮点,这类问题常常背景新颖,并与函数、数列、不等

8、式等交汇自然,很好地考查考生的信息处理能力及综合运用知识解决问题的能力.算法与函数的交汇【典例1】(2013年高考全国新课标卷Ⅰ)执行下面的程序框图,如果输入的t∈[-1,3],则输出的s属于()A.[-3,4]B.[-5,2]C.[-4,3]D.[-2,5][答案]A由题悟道本题实质是涉及条件结构程序

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。